GPT-6 Astra Optimizes ChatGPT Subscription Usage, Heavy Scenarios Deduct Up to 75%
OpenAI has optimized the ChatGPT subscription usage for GPT-6 Astra. Tibo, the core product lead, stated that the model quality remains unchanged. In some heavy scenarios, the subscription usage can be reduced to about 1/3 to 1/4 of the previous consumption. This optimization mainly targets the ChatGPT subscription usage, and the official has not disclosed the specific mechanism, but it seems that the usage calculation on the subscription side has been adjusted. In the past two days, there have been multiple reports on OpenAI's GitHub about Astra usage depleting too quickly. Some Plus users reported reaching their limits in about 20 minutes, while Pro 20x users indicated they consumed a large portion of their weekly quota within a day.
